HouseholdsIn Kaukauna (Outagamie County), WI, the aggregate number of households is 76,859 |
Median IncomeHouseholds in the city of Kaukauna (Outagamie County), WI have a median income of $58,260. |
PopulationThe total population in the city of Kaukauna (Outagamie County), WI is 184,895 |
DSL TechnologyApproximately 76.27% of consumers in the city of Kaukauna (Outagamie County), WI have access to DSL internet |
Fiber TechnologyApproximately 0.3% of consumers in the city of Kaukauna (Outagamie County), WI have access to fiber-optic internet. |
Cable TechnologyApproximately 94.06% of consumers in the city of Kaukauna (Outagamie County), WI have access to cable internet. |
Wireless TechnologyApproximately 100% of consumers in the city of Kaukauna (Outagamie County), WI have access to mobile broadband internet. |
Average upload speedFor residents in the city of Kaukauna, WI, the city-wide average upload speed is 6 Mbps |
Average download speedFor residents in the city of Kaukauna, WI, the city-wide average download speed is 9 Mbps. |

DSL Providers in Kaukauna, WI
DSL or Digital Subscriber Line is an internet connection that is streamed through conventional, analog telephone lines. By utilizing phone lines, internet users use extra bandwidth from phone lines to use their internet. DSL users connect to the internet through a DSL modem. DSL modems connect to phone lines and the service provider then allows connection to the Internet through a digital subscriber line access multiplexer. Kaukauna, WI Satellite Internet Providers
Satellite dishes facilitate satellite internet service. Customers are required to connect a modem to their satellite dish. The satellite allows internet connection by transmitting frequencies to a modem through the dish.
Satellite is preferable for users in rural areas because telephone and cable companies are not always readily available for all the clients in remote places. The other reason is that the services might be slow and costly due to low-quality connection and distance respectively.
